Rivista Editions

The Society鈥檚 magazine, Rivista, offers a richly-illustrated record of the entertaining and informative talks delivered by our prestigious speakers during the Society鈥檚 year. The range of topics is wide – from history to culture, economics, business, the arts, music, sport and modern life in the peninsula.

Rivista also covers the Society鈥檚 social events and charitable activities, and includes features and articles of general interest about Italy and Italian culture. First published, in August 1946, as a roneoed monthly bulletin, Notiziario Italiano, which reprinted news and comment from the Italian press and carried transcripts of lectures, the publication has developed into today鈥檚 printed (and online) annual journal.
